Parsnips are sweet, earthy root vegetables that bring a mellow nuttiness to comfort-food recipes. They look similar to pale carrots but cook up softer and richer, making them excellent for roasting, blending into soups, or adding body to stews.

Use parsnips anywhere you want a naturally sweet, savory base: tray bakes, creamy purees, mashed root vegetables, gratins, pot pies, and slow-cooked braises. Their flavor deepens with caramelization, so high-heat roasting is one of the best ways to make them shine.

For balanced recipes, pair parsnips with herbs, butter, garlic, mustard, citrus, apples, potatoes, carrots, chicken, pork, or lentils. Smaller parsnips tend to be tender and sweet, while very large ones may have a woody core that is best trimmed away before cooking.
